From Overwhelm to Finished, Functional and Refreshed

Haddon Township, NJ

This family wanted to enhance their home’s functionality and aesthetics. Their primary goals included expanding the kitchen, relocating the laundry to the main floor, and creating a primary suite on the second floor. The project also aimed to optimize space and minimize unnecessary costs by rethinking the existing room layouts.

Initial Challenges:
Initially, they engaged with an architect years ago, but the complexity and scale of the initial plans were overwhelming, leading them to repeatedly delay the project. Upon reaching out to our team, we quickly understood their vision and explored innovative solutions to meet their needs without excessive expansion.

Design and Planning:
During our first appointment, we identified opportunities to reconfigure existing spaces, thereby minimizing the size of the new addition. Key changes included swapping the existing family room and dining room, which provided a more efficient layout for the new kitchen and adjacent spaces.

Key Elements of the Remodel:

Kitchen Expansion
Relocated to form a spacious “L” shape with an oversized island, creating a functional and stylish central hub for the home. The new kitchen seamlessly connects to the newly positioned dining room.

Main Floor Laundry
A new laundry area was created off the kitchen, moving it from the basement to the main floor for added convenience.

Primary Suite Creation
The second floor was redesigned to include a new primary suite, complete with ample closet space and an en-suite bathroom. This was achieved by adding a second story over the new kitchen area.

Preservation of Character
T
he Keoughs’ preference for a sleek, timeless style was incorporated into the new design, ensuring harmony between the addition and the original home. Original character details, such as trim and interior doors, were preserved or duplicated to maintain the home’s charm.
